Key Frontend Features to Maximize ROI Calculator Impact for Dental Clinics

To ensure your ROI calculator resonates with dental clinic managers, it must blend technical sophistication with dental industry relevance. Below are ten essential frontend features, complete with implementation guidance and practical examples, designed to meet and exceed user expectations.

1. Real-Time Interactive Inputs: Provide Instant, Personalized ROI Insights

Overview:
Enable users to input clinic-specific data—such as monthly new patient counts or marketing budgets—and instantly view updated ROI calculations without page reloads.

Why It Matters:
Dental managers benefit from dynamically exploring “what-if” scenarios, allowing them to quickly understand how changes affect financial outcomes. This immediacy fosters engagement and informed decision-making.

Implementation Tips:

  • Use reactive frameworks like React or Vue.js to bind inputs to application state for seamless updates.
  • Apply debounce techniques to optimize performance during rapid input changes.
  • Incorporate intuitive UI elements such as sliders for patient volume and dropdowns for marketing channels.

Example:
A slider lets managers adjust patient volume from 100 to 500 patients monthly, instantly reflecting ROI fluctuations.

2. Display Dental Industry-Specific Metrics: Speak the Language of Dental Clinic Managers

Overview:
Present KPIs tailored to dental operations—such as patient retention rate, average revenue per patient, and chair utilization rate—instead of generic financial metrics.

Why It Matters:
Managers trust and engage more with metrics that reflect their daily realities. Using industry-specific KPIs reduces confusion and increases the tool’s perceived relevance and credibility.

Implementation Tips:

  • Collaborate with dental professionals to identify and validate key performance indicators.
  • Replace generic terms like “conversion rate” with “patient retention rate.”
  • Align calculations with dental industry benchmarks to enhance trustworthiness.

Example:
Show how increasing patient retention from 70% to 80% can significantly boost ROI, making the benefits tangible.

3. Integrate Dynamic Visual Data Representations: Simplify Complex ROI Data

Overview:
Use interactive charts, graphs, and progress bars that update in real time based on user inputs to visually communicate financial trends and outcomes.

Why It Matters:
Visualizations help managers quickly grasp complex data, identify patterns, and make informed decisions.

Implementation Tips:

  • Utilize charting libraries such as Chart.js, D3.js, or Google Charts for responsive, engaging visuals.
  • Apply color coding (e.g., green for positive ROI, red for negative) to intuitively signal performance.
  • Add tooltips to explain data points and trends on hover.

Example:
A bar chart compares monthly costs versus returns over a year, highlighting seasonal fluctuations.

4. Enable Scenario Comparison Features: Facilitate Strategic Investment Decisions

Overview:
Allow users to create, save, and compare multiple ROI scenarios side-by-side to evaluate different investment strategies.

Why It Matters:
Dental managers often need to weigh current performance against potential improvements before allocating resources.

Implementation Tips:

  • Implement UI toggles or tabs for seamless switching between scenarios.
  • Store scenario data locally (e.g., localStorage) or on backend servers for persistence.
  • Highlight differences in ROI outcomes visually to emphasize potential gains or risks.

Example:
Compare ROI before and after adopting a new patient scheduling system to justify the investment.

5. Ensure Mobile Responsiveness and Accessibility: Support Managers On-the-Go

Overview:
Design the calculator to perform flawlessly across devices and be accessible to users with disabilities.

Why It Matters:
Dental managers frequently access tools on tablets or smartphones during busy schedules. Accessibility compliance broadens the user base and meets legal standards.

Implementation Tips:

  • Use responsive CSS frameworks like Tailwind CSS or Bootstrap for adaptable layouts.
  • Follow WCAG 2.1 guidelines for color contrast, keyboard navigation, and screen reader compatibility.
  • Employ semantic HTML5 elements to improve structure and SEO.

Example:
Input fields sized for touch interaction and color schemes that meet accessibility standards.

6. Add Educational Tooltips and Contextual Help: Demystify Complex Terms

Overview:
Provide on-hover or click-triggered explanations that clarify inputs and metrics.

Why It Matters:
Not all dental clinic managers are familiar with financial jargon or specific KPIs. Tooltips reduce confusion and support accurate data entry.

Implementation Tips:

  • Integrate lightweight tooltip libraries like Tippy.js or Popper.js.
  • Craft concise, jargon-free explanations tailored to dental practices.
  • Link to detailed documentation or case studies for users seeking deeper understanding.

Example:
A tooltip explaining “Chair Utilization Rate” and its direct impact on clinic efficiency.

7. Deliver Personalized Recommendations: Translate Insights into Action

Overview:
Generate tailored next steps or service suggestions based on ROI results to guide managers toward improvement.

Why It Matters:
Personalized advice increases user satisfaction and helps convert insights into tangible business actions.

Implementation Tips:

  • Use conditional logic to categorize ROI outcomes (e.g., low, medium, high).
  • Map specific recommendations to each category—such as marketing automation for clinics with low ROI.
  • Present recommendations inline or offer downloadable PDF summaries.

Example:
If ROI is below 10%, suggest cost optimization strategies or technology upgrades.

9. Optimize Load Speed and Frontend Performance: Retain User Engagement

Overview:
Ensure the calculator loads quickly and responds instantly to user interactions.

Why It Matters:
Slow-loading tools frustrate users and increase bounce rates, reducing adoption.

Implementation Tips:

  • Minimize JavaScript bundles using code splitting and tree shaking with tools like Webpack or Rollup.
  • Compress images and use scalable SVG icons.
  • Lazy-load non-essential components.
  • Monitor performance with Google Lighthouse and WebPageTest.

Example:
Achieve initial load times under 2 seconds on 4G connections for smooth user experience.
